Ray Rice of the Baltimore Ravens has been cut from the team in light of a video surfacing of Rice physically assaulting his then-fiancée in February.
The video, released by TMZ is a grainy, low quality version of the official police copy leaked to the Associated Press by a law-enforcement official Monday. The Ravens administration said Monday afternoon that this was the first they knew of the video, and that in response to it Rice’s $4 million contract was terminated. Back in February, Rice was charged with felony aggravated assault, and in May was accepted into a pre-trial intervention program that could drop jail time and lead to the charge being purged from his record. He has been suspended indefinitely from the NFL.
